Dear fellow hikers: when there are no sidewalks, it is New York State law to walk against traffic (left side of the road). Literally every other hiker we saw to and from the parking lot was walking on the right.
This is a good walking area, not for people with bad knees and who can't cope with walking on rough ground. Take plenty of water, food and snacks, there's no facilities (toilet at Tuxedo railroad station). If you go by train from NYC give yourself plenty of time to get back to the train.
I relatively like the hiking courses in the Ramapo area, and hiking here is also fun because there are intermittent streams and various courses. I walked Claudius Smith’s Den Short Loop clockwise for 5 miles in 2 hours and 30 minutes.
Amazing hike (year round) from this trailhead (park at the train station & walk in). A few hours or all day - we did 11 miles on a sunny & icy January weekday and it was gorgeous. Only saw 2 other hikers all day.
